spiritual realm

   
  The bible gives us glimpses into another sphere or realm which we can not see with our physical eyes. Chapter 10 in the book of Daniel is probably the most elaborate part in the bible to give us an idea of the spiritual realm. The most distinct reference in the New Testament is Paul's teaching in Ephesians chapter 6:

EPH 6:12 For our struggle is not against flesh and blood, but against the rulers, against the powers, against the world forces of this darkness, against the spiritual forces of wickedness in the heavenly places.

and also Paul's definition of the devil as the prince of the air:
EPH 2:2 in which you formerly walked according to the course of this world, according to the prince of the power of the air, of the spirit that is now working in the sons of disobedience.

In this realm there is obviously a fight going on between the angles of God and the demons of satan. The fight is about controlling persons and incidences on the earth. The believer who has learned to discern spiritual influences will feel the reactions of this fight as spirits of good or evil in life.

Many more bible verses teach us, that angles are on duty on our behalf:

Mt 18:10 “See that you do not look down on one of these little ones. For I tell you that their angels in heaven always see the face of my Father in heaven.
Heb 1:14 Are not all angels ministering spirits sent to serve those who will inherit salvation?
Ps 34:7 The Angel of the LORD encamps around those who fear him, and he delivers them.
Ge 48:16 the Angel who has delivered me from all harm        (says Jacob)

We can also clearly see, that there is a connection between us fearing God and having angels fighting for us against satan. We are receiving protection from the devil through the spiritual realm.
When we turn from God however and go our own way, disobeying God's commandments and sinning against HIM this protection diminishes. God removing HIS protection through the spiritual realm is most elaborate in Leviticus 26:14-46. God setting HIS face against us is synonym for removing HIS protecting hand from us and giving the devil free way.

God makes it very clear to us that our sins have devastating consequences on our lives. In Genesis 4:7 God says "If you do what is right, will you not be accepted? But if you do not do what is right, sin is crouching at your door; it desires to have you, but you must master it.” We can conclude, that even sin itself has spiritual power, because it desires us.

The good news is, that we have HIS complete Word, the bible today. By studying and meditating on HIS Word we have the chance to avoid the bad consequences by obeying HIS commandments and decrees. Through the blood of Christ and His atonement for our sin we can be forgiven, turn from our ways to HIS way and get under HIS cover and protection again. Through HIS power we can resist sin and master it.

2CH 7:14 and My people who are called by My name humble themselves and pray and seek My face and turn from their wicked ways, then I will hear from heaven, will forgive their sin and will heal their land.
